DEMYSTIFY


Meaning of DEMYSTIFY in English

[de.mys.ti.fy] vt (1963): to eliminate the mystifying features of -- de.mys.ti.fi.ca.tion n

Merriam-Webster English vocab.      Английский словарь Merriam Webster.